About the Stone → Grama conversion
Conversions of weight are essential in many everyday and technical contexts. Using consistent units and accurate factors ensures precise results.
The exact factor between Stone and Grama is 6350.29335815. This means that 1 st equals 6350.29335815 g. To convert any value, just multiply. For the reverse direction, divide.

Conversion table
| Stone (st) | Grama (g) |
|---|---|
| 1 | 6350.2934 |
| 2 | 12700.5867 |
| 5 | 31751.4668 |
| 10 | 63502.9336 |
| 25 | 158757.334 |
| 50 | 317514.6679 |
| 100 | 635029.3358 |
| 250 | 1587573.3395 |
| 500 | 3175146.6791 |
| 1000 | 6350293.3582 |
Reverse conversion
1 g = 0.00015747 st
